A reset you can save
A banked reset is a redeemable entitlement shown to eligible users. Unlike a hard reset, it does not automatically rewrite everyone’s active quota when it is issued. The available count, eligibility, expiry, and redemption surface can vary by offer and plan.
Always use the offer details and Usage view in your own Codex account. Do not paste access tokens or local authentication files into third-party websites to check eligibility.
Why reports get confused
A person who redeems a banked reset may report that “Codex reset,” while another user sees no change. Both observations can be true because the event was account-specific. Public hard resets, by contrast, are intended to restore an active allowance for a broader stated group.
